LITTLE ROCK, AR – A memorial fund has been set up for the victim of Monday’s Plaza Towers fire.

72-year-old Vertis Brown died Wednesday from injuries suffered in the fire. The family needs assistance with her final expenses.

Donations can be made at any Arvest Bank. Just ask for the donation to be put in the “Memorial Fund for Vertis Brown.”
